Vue CLI4配置教程:详解vue.config.js与画布控件应用
需积分: 50 137 浏览量
更新于2024-08-09
收藏 1.02MB PDF 举报
"《思考Python》是一本引导读者像计算机科学家一样思考的书籍,作者Allen Downey。这本书在多个版本中不断更新,旨在帮助读者理解Python编程,并深入学习计算机科学概念。书中强调通过实际编程来学习,鼓励读者动手实践。书中包含的画布控件部分介绍了如何在Python中创建和操作画布,包括设置画布尺寸、颜色以及在画布上绘制图形如圆形等。同时,还提到了如何响应用户交互,例如通过按钮触发事件来在画布上绘制图形。"
在《思考Python》中,19.3章节讨论了"画布控件",这是一个在GUI编程中非常重要的概念。画布是一个可以用来绘制各种形状和元素的区域,它允许程序员进行图形化操作。在Vue CLI4的环境中,我们可以利用JavaScript或相关的前端框架(如Vue.js)来实现类似的功能,尽管这里提到的是Python的实现。
在Python中创建一个画布是通过`g.ca()`方法完成的,可以指定宽度和高度,单位为像素。之后,我们可以使用`config()`方法修改画布的属性,例如将背景颜色设为白色。Python支持多种颜色名称,如白色、黑色、红色等。在画布上绘制图形,如圆形,可以使用`circle()`方法,传入圆心坐标和半径,并设置填充颜色。这里提到的`fill`选项用于设定图形内部的颜色,而`outline`则用于设定图形边框的颜色和宽度。
在GUI编程中,用户交互是必不可少的。书中举例说明,可以通过创建一个按钮,然后监听按钮的点击事件,在事件处理函数中执行画圆的操作。这样的交互性设计使得程序更加生动且易于用户操作。
练习19.2进一步巩固了这些概念,要求读者编写一个程序,包含一个画布和一个按钮。当用户点击按钮时,程序会在画布上绘制一个圆。这不仅涉及到了画布控件的基本操作,还涉及到事件处理和用户交互的设计,是将理论知识与实际编程相结合的好例子。
《思考Python》通过清晰的解释和实用的示例,教导读者如何使用Python的画布控件进行图形绘制,并理解计算机科学中的基本概念。同时,这个例子也展示了如何在前端开发中,特别是在Vue CLI4的配置中,可以借鉴类似的逻辑来实现用户界面的交互功能。
2020-12-12 上传
2020-10-15 上传
2020-10-15 上传
2021-02-06 上传
2024-12-01 上传
2020-11-20 上传
2020-12-07 上传
2020-12-02 上传
2023-03-16 上传
烧白滑雪
- 粉丝: 29
- 资源: 3846
最新资源
- 编译器2
- 电子功用-多层陶瓷电子元件用介电糊的制备方法
- JLex and CUP Java based Decompiler-开源
- 管理系统系列--自动发卡系统(包含前台以及后台管理系统),对接payjs支付(无须企业认证).zip
- 整齐的块
- goit-markup-hw-03
- (课程设计)00.00-99.99 数字电子秒表(原理图、PCB、仿真电路及程序等)-电路方案
- DiskUsage.0:适用于 Android 的 DiskUsage 应用程序
- HonorLee.me:我的Hexo博客
- DZ3-卡塔琳娜·米尔伊科维奇
- 管理系统系列--智慧农业集成管理系统.zip
- 毕业设计:基于Java web的学生信息管理系统
- (资料汇总)PCF8591模块 AD/DA转换模块(原理图、测试程序、使用说明等)-电路方案
- CampaignFinancePHL:使费城的竞选财务数据更易于理解
- Week09-Day02
- JiraNodeClient:用于从Jira导出导入数据的NodeJS工具